Basic Information

Product Name 3-Pyridinemethanol,α-Ethyl-,(S)-(9Ci)
CAS No. 127633-95-8
Molecular Formula C8H11NO
Molecular Weight 137.18 g/mol
Synonyms (S)-α-Ethyl-3-pyridinemethanol; (S)-(-)-α-Ethyl-3-pyridinemethanol; (S)-1-(3-Pyridyl)-1-propanol; (S)-α-Ethyl-3-pyridylcarbinol; (S)-3-(1-Hydroxypropyl)pyridine; (S)-3-Pyridinepropanol, α-ethyl-; (S)-HPP; (S)-3-Pyridylpropanol

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at a controlled room temperature (15-25°C). This material is hygroscopic (moisture-sensitive) and should be handled under an inert atmosphere for long-term storage to maintain purity and prevent degradation.
